So i have an old but beautiful Macbook Pro mid 2010 and last week these spots appeared on the screen. A couple of days after, the black line got bigger and i’m afraid this Mac is reaching his final days. Can you identify these spots? Are these dead pixels? Any of you experienced this?
Thanks for any help you can give me.

It does appear to be dead pixels. But to make sure, you should try attaching an external monitor or TV to your MBP to see if that looks okay. If the external monitor is okay, then you know the problem is with the MBP display.
